Abstract

A fastener driving tool that includes a lifter subassembly for moving the driver from a driven position to a ready position. In one embodiment, the lifter is mounted to a movable pivot arm, and if the driver is mispositioned at the beginning of a lifting phase, the lifter can displace a small distance to allow the lifter to move over the driver's protrusions, thereby allowing the lifting phase to continue without causing a jam. A retainer (or “cam follower”) is positioned along a rounded cam profile surface of at least one lifter disk to prevent the lifter from displacing during later portions of the lifting phase, or during a transition phase. The lifter includes at least two rotating disks with extending pins to engage driver protrusions. One of the lifter disks can have gear teeth on its perimeter, instead of a cam profile surface.
